This print showcases a meticulous drawing of a man's skeleton, rendered in rich brown pen and ink on paper. Created by the talented artist James Ward (1769-1859), this artwork measures 52.5x33 cm and is part of the esteemed Paul Mellon Collection at the Yale Center for British Art in the USA. The intricate details and precise lines bring to life the skeletal structure, evoking both fascination and contemplation. This piece serves as a study of anatomy, shedding light on our mortal existence and reminding us of our own mortality. With its origins dating back to the 18th or 19th century, this drawing offers an invaluable glimpse into medical scenes from that era.
